The Dodge 5604649AD 11-16 Caravan Town Country Clock Spring Steering Angle Sensor is a crucial component for ensuring accurate steering and vehicle stability. This sensor is specifically designed for Dodge Caravans manufactured between 2011 and 2016.
The sensor operates by measuring the steering angle of your vehicle, which is essential for various vehicle systems, including anti-lock braking (ABS), stability control, and traction control. By providing this vital information, the sensor helps the car's computer systems to make necessary adjustments to maintain safe and controlled driving conditions.
